Evidence log

  • 2026-08-21 — Rescission of Executive Order 11246 Implementing Regulations: cross-connection with eo-11246-federal-contractor-affirmative-action: OFCCP historically enforced both EO 11246 (race/sex) and Section 503 (disability) contractor obligations; rescission of the EO 11246 rules leaves Section 503 disability affirmative action as a separate, still-active regime. (novelty: 4)
  • 2026-08-21 — Modifications to the Regulations Implementing Section 503 of the Rehabilitation Act of 1973, as Amended: Labor Department issued a final rule modifying the Section 503 implementing regulations governing federal contractors’ recruitment, hiring, and advancement of workers with disabilities, aligning the affirmative-action framework with White House directives on merit-based opportunity and deregulation.
